Output 81ea265c2f002f639aebbe17546b4b096293259a3f96f7bc44f2bc8a34fce94c:0

value
88818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02088e77d9b093c8eb89d0640afe2fc12c619656 OP_EQUAL
address
31smXSjr4h51u9Ao2WJnKyhuJCqH4FpMd2
transaction
81ea265c2f002f639aebbe17546b4b096293259a3f96f7bc44f2bc8a34fce94c